`
chaletli
  • 浏览: 8307 次
  • 性别: Icon_minigender_1
  • 来自: 上海
社区版块
存档分类
最新评论
文章列表
最近自己在用SWT做个小插件,需要用到系统热键,但是热键只能在当前shell激活的状态下才有效,于是网上各种找。。。终于找到了JIntellitype 。   用JIntellitype 注册热键参考代码如下:   //第二个参数为组合键,如果为0,则认为是没有组合键,118代表了F8 JIntellitype.getInstance().registerHotKey(1, 0, 118);//hide shell //组合键的应用 //JIntellitype.getInstance().registerHotKey(1, JIntellitype.MOD_CONTROL, (i ...
最近同事问到一个涉及到Java反射的问题,整理下来如下:   需求:给定父对象,和map关系如下:     MyObject1 myObject1 = new MyObject1();  Map<String, Object> resultMap = new HashMap<String,Object>();  resultMap.put("myObject1.myobject2.mysub1.name", "sub1Name");  resultMap.put("myObject1.myobject2.mysub ...
如题:   当我用window.open打开一个新页面的时候,如果当前是有全屏的程序(比如一个用SWT开发的总是显示最前的程序)在的,并且全屏的程序也是置顶显示的,那么怎么才能让我新打开的页面在全屏程序之前呢?   貌似这个是IE一直在反对的?因为感觉这样相当于操作浏览器的事件。。。   我试过window.showModelessDialog弹出的页面是显示在最前的,但非模式窗口是多线程的,也就是当有新窗口打开时,总是打开一个新的窗口,不能在同一个窗口中打开。
Global site tag (gtag.js) - Google Analytics